0
0

В панели разработчика на 1200px , align-items: centre; перечеркнуто.

/* style */

@import 'base/variables';
* {
    font-family: 'Museo Sans Cyrl', sans-serif;
}
.container {
    max-width: 950px;
    margin: 0 auto;
}
@import 'blocks/promo';
@import 'blocks/header.scss';
@import 'blocks/buttons';
@import 'blocks/advantages';
@import 'blocks/titles';
@import 'blocks/consultation';
@import 'blocks/forms';
@import 'blocks/carousel';
@import 'blocks/catalog';
@import 'blocks/feed';

/*_promo */

@import '../base/media';
.promo {
    min-height: 650px;
    padding: 21px 0 93px 0;
    background: url("../img/big/bg1.png") center (center/cover) no-repeat;
    &__wrapper {
        display: flex;
        flex-direction: column;
        align-items: flex-end;
        margin-top: 90px;

/*_media */

@media (max-width: 1200px) {
	.promo {
		&__wrapper {
			align-items: center;
		}
	}
}

Алексей Нобелев
3 years ago






раз перечеркнуто, смотри дальше, какой-то следующий стиль перебивает

student_kAR68Gv3
3 years ago

Так это понятно. Что сделать, чтобы не перебивал?

Алексей Нобелев
3 years ago

если лень искать, для этого придуман !important  а если нужен чистый код думай, ищи

student_kAR68Gv3
3 years ago

Добрый день. important лучше не использовать, так как может приводить к проблемам)

Если перечеркивается - значит стиль перебивается и нужно искать причину. Это может быть из-за:

- неправильной последовательности подключения. media всегда должно быть в конце, иначе будет перебиваться. А в каком месте подключен _media?

- неправильный селектор, но судя по коду тут все в порядке.

Иван Петриченко
3 years ago

4 ответов